SAVOY CABARET

Among the attractions of Dunedin to-night is the supper dance at the Savoy, and realising that patronage will be forthcoming from many visitors the management has set itself out to show to-night what quality of cabaret entertainment Dunedin has to offer. The music will be supplied by the Savoy Orchestra, which is in the forefront of the dominion dance bands, with _ Alf Carey, tho violinist-saxo-phonist, as leader.
